Enum sn_data_types::DataAddress [−][src]
pub enum DataAddress { Blob(BlobAddress), Map(MapAddress), Sequence(SequenceAddress), Register(RegisterAddress), }
Object storing an address of data on the network
Variants
Blob(BlobAddress)
Blob Address
Map(MapAddress)
Map Address
Sequence(SequenceAddress)
Sequence Address
Register(RegisterAddress)
Register Address
